Clay Symbols aren't namespace aware - would be nice to have, wouldnt it

The imported content is precompiled and added after that, because of
that, namespaces declared in other files don't get applied to the
included ones.

> I'm a step closer - it's something to do with the namespace
> declarations. If I do this...
> 
>        <span jsfid="h:outputText" value="hello" />
>        <h:outputText xmlns:h="http://java.sun.com/jsf/html";
> value="hello" />
> 
> Then the page renders as 
> 
>  Hello hello
> 
> So the question becomes: why is my namespace declaration in the <html>
> tag being ignored in the content page? 
> 
> Further explaination: as I said, I'm using full XML views, so the <html>
> tag is defined in a separate file (layout.html) and the content
> (example.html) is pulled in using a <span jsfid="clay"
> clayJsfid="example.html"> dynamic import.
> 
> It appears that the imported content file isn't inheriting values parsed
> in the parent. Is there somewhere I can set up the namespaces so that
> all the content html pages will be aware of them; that is, is there a
> common root I can use? Having to re-declare the namespaces in every page
> will be a right pain!
